Overview

Explore the concept of ambiguity in game production and learn effective methods for determining its impact in this 2017 GDC session presented by Oculus' Ruth Tomandl. Gain insights into navigating uncertain situations and producing quality work even when faced with unclear directions or goals. Discover strategies for embracing ambiguity as a potential asset rather than a hindrance in game development, and learn how to leverage it to foster creativity and innovation. Delve into practical approaches for managing ambiguous scenarios, making informed decisions, and maintaining productivity in the face of uncertainty.
